Rugged Exposure Binoculars: POCZE Waterproof and Durable 12x42 Binoculars

pocze-binoculars-for-adults-12x42-waterproof-and-durable-binoculars-with-multi-coated-optics-and-pro-1

Experience stunning views with the POCZE Binoculars for Adults, designed to bring you closer to nature. With a 12x magnification and 42mm objective lenses, these binoculars deliver exceptional resolution, vibrant colors, and edge-to-edge sharpness. The fully multi-coated process increases light transmission, while the roof prism design ensures durability and a compact size.

Adjustable eyecups cater to users with or without eyeglasses, and the center focus wheel simplifies adjusting the focus of both barrels simultaneously. The diopter, located on the right eyepiece, accommodates differences in a user’s eyes.

These waterproof and fogproof binoculars provide reliable performance in any environment, thanks to argon purging and O-ring seals. Rubber armor offers a secure, non-slip grip and external protection, making them perfect for hiking, birdwatching, and hunting expeditions. Rugged construction allows them to withstand recoil and impact, ensuring long-lasting use.

Enjoy the perfect companion for your next outdoor adventure with the POCZE Binoculars, as they can be used on a tripod or car window mount for even more versatility.

Swarovski 10x25 CL Pocket Binoculars - Anthracite, Rugged Design for Comfortable Viewing

swarovski-10x25-cl-pocket-binoculars-anthracite-mountain-1

The Swarovski CL Pocket Binoculars are a small but mighty tool for those who love the outdoors. These binoculars offer 10x magnification, allowing you to see even the smallest details of your surroundings. The 25mm objective lens provides a field of view of 294 feet at 1,000 yards, making it perfect for nature enthusiasts.

Designed for maximum comfort, these binoculars fit perfectly in your hand and can be used for extended periods without causing strain. The twist-in eyecups can be adjusted individually, ensuring that eyeglass wearers can make the most of their view as well.

The CL Pocket Binoculars feature a rugged exterior with black rubber armoring, reinforced hinges, and a cozy Mountain case. The focus mechanism has been smoothed out for a more pleasant feel, and a rainguard has been added to protect the optics from the elements.

The optics of these binoculars remain the same, offering a close focus of 8.2 feet and phase-corrected BaK-4 roof prisms. Weighing just 10.2 ounces without straps, these binoculars are lightweight and easy to carry, making them ideal for those who enjoy outdoor activities.

Zeiss 20x60 S Stabilization Waterproof Binoculars - Image Stabilization and Excellent Low-Light Viewing

zeiss-20x60-classic-s-image-stabilization-binocular-1

Revolutionizing the realm of optics, the Zeiss 20x60 Classic S Binoculars harness cutting-edge image stabilization to deliver exceptional high-resolution and image quality. Ideal for stargazing and observing the fascinating minutiae of nature, such as Arctic foxes against snowy backdrops, these binoculars boast mechanical image stabilization, eliminating the need for batteries, and providing a seamless, steady viewing experience. Crafted with enduring Zeiss high-quality materials, these robust binoculars boast a rugged metal housing encompassed in black rubber armoring, offering a secure and comfortable grip while enhancing durability.

The standout features of these binoculars include the outstanding 20x magnification and the generously sized 60mm lenses, ensuring enhanced light intake for captivating images even in challenging low-light conditions. In addition, these binoculars offer individual eyepiece focus, a close focusing range of 45.9 feet, and a diopter adjustment range of -7 to 7 dpt. The interpupillary distance adjustment range of 57 to 73 mm can conveniently accommodate individuals with broader facial structures.

Important Features

Rugged-Exposure-Binoculars-2

When looking for rugged exposure binoculars, there are several essential features to consider. These features include waterproofing, fog-proofing, shock resistance, and field of view. Waterproof binoculars are designed to resist water and moisture, keeping your view clear even in wet conditions. Fog-proof binoculars are treated with a special coating that prevents fogging, ensuring a clear view in humid environments. Shock-resistant binoculars can withstand drops and impacts without damage, making them a reliable choice for outdoor enthusiasts. Lastly, a wide field of view allows you to see more of the landscape, making it easier to spot wildlife, landmarks, and other points of interest.

How do I choose the right Rugged Exposure Binocular for my needs?

Choosing the right Rugged Exposure Binocular for your needs depends on several factors, including the intended use (birdwatching, stargazing, sports watching), magnification requirements, and personal preferences. You should consider factors such as the objective lens size, field of view, eyepiece exit pupil, and weight. Some models provide a more extensive field of view, which is ideal for tracking fast-moving animals or for quickly locating and following moving subjects

You should also consider the magnification range of the binoculars to suit your intended use. For birdwatching or stargazing, a higher magnification (8x to 12x or even 15x) would be more suitable as it allows for a closer and more detailed view. However, for sports observation or events, you might prefer a lower magnification binocular (e. g. , 7x or 8x) to create a wider field of view for tracking objects in motion. Lastly, it’s crucial to identify a model with user-friendly features, such as diopter-adjustment or a focus-free eyepiece if you plan to use the binoculars for extended periods.
